Carolina Reserve of Hendersonville Costs & Pricing

Carolina Reserve of Hendersonville offers competitive pricing for its accommodations, particularly when compared to both Henderson County and the broader North Carolina region. For a semi-private room, residents can expect to pay $3,995 per month, which is slightly above the county average of $3,904 but higher than the state average of $3,584. Meanwhile, for studio apartments, the monthly cost is $5,305 - significantly exceeding both the county rate of $4,645 and the state average of $4,020. These figures reflect a commitment to providing quality care and facilities tailored to meet diverse needs while also indicating that Carolina Reserve positions itself as a premium option within its market.

Overall Review of Carolina Reserve of Hendersonville

common 5 reviews mention this

Cleanliness stands out

Several reviews highlight a clean, fresh-smelling community environment.

Multiple residents and families describe the building as clean and well-kept, including comments about good smells and no noticeable odors. Some reviewers also mention the overall look and upkeep during visits. A few others, however, call out problems like rooms being dirty or not handled properly, which shows cleanliness can vary by situation.

caveat 9 reviews mention this

Food quality is mixed

Food quality is a major theme, with reviews split between praise and complaints.

Some families say the meals are excellent, with residents eating well and enjoying dining experiences. Others describe the food as terrible or awful, including comments about needing major improvements. Even when the staff is described positively, the negative dining feedback comes up often enough to feel like a recurring concern.

common 8 reviews mention this

Activities and music help

Residents benefit from regular activities, including music events that families notice.

Reviews frequently describe the community as keeping residents engaged with activities such as art, sing-alongs, and group events. Music shows up as a specific point families connect to better mood and engagement. At the same time, at least a few reviewers mention stretches with fewer activities, and some describe boredom as the main issue for their loved ones.

caveat 5 reviews mention this

Memory care needs more stimulation

Memory care experiences can feel limited for residents who need stimulation.

Several reviews connect the memory care side to how much mental or social engagement residents receive. Some families say their loved one did well in memory care, while others describe residents as wandering, sleeping, or not getting the stimulation they needed. A recurring concern is boredom, including requests for more variety and more consistent music in common spaces.
